Software Engineer Ii - Frontend Development Job in Chegg India Pvt. Ltd.

Software Engineer Ii - Frontend Development

Apply Now
Job Summary
  • Implementation of a robust set of services and APIs to power the web application
  • Building reusable code and libraries for future use
  • Optimization of the application for maximum speed and scalability
  • Implementation of security and data protection
  • Translation of UI/UX wireframes to visual elements
  • Integration of the front-end and back-end aspects of the web application
  • Understand business requirements and convert them into visual elements that can be represented in UI
  • Develop new user-facing features
  • Ensure the technical feasibility of UI/UX designs
  • Assure that all user input is validated before submitting to back-end
  • Collaborate with other team members and stakeholders

Skills Required :
  • Good understanding of Object Oriented JavaScript.
  • The overall experience of 3+ years with UI technologies (preferably in a E-commerce/Edutech Product company)
  • Strong hands-on experience in any of theseadvanced JavaScript libraries and frameworks such as AngularJS, KnockoutJS, BackboneJS, ReactJS, DurandalJS etc.
  • Proficient understanding of client-side scripting and JavaScript frameworks, includingjQuery, Zepto, MooTools, etc.
  • Proficient understanding of code versioning toolsGit, Bitbucket etc.
  • Familiarity with development aiding tools likeBower, Bundler, Rake, Gulp, etc.
  • Proficient knowledge of a back-end programming languagePHP
  • Understanding differences between multiple delivery platforms (such as mobile vs, desktop),and optimizing output to match the specific platform
  • Good understanding of server-side CSS preprocessorssuch as Stylus, Less, Sass etc.
  • Management of hosting UI environments likedev and testing
  • administration and scaling an application to support load changes
  • Understanding of fundamental design principles behind a scalable application
  • Ability to implementautomated testing platforms and unit tests
  • Nice to have knowledge on server-side templating languagessuch as Jade, EJS, Jinja, etc.
Experience Required :

Fresher

Vacancy :

2 - 4 Hires

Similar Jobs for you

See more recommended jobs